The Spectrogram S is a fascinating tool that allows for the visualization of sounds in a unique way. When analyzing the sounds "Bha4" and "Bha" in the spectogram, one can see the distinct patterns that emerge. The sharp peaks and valleys of the spectogram indicate the presence of plosives, which are sounds produced by a sudden release of air. The plosives present in the sounds "Bha4" and "Bha" are clearly visible on the spectogram, characterized by sharp spikes in intensity followed by a rapid decrease. These burst-like patterns indicate the abrupt release of air during the production of plosive sounds, creating a distinct visual representation on the spectogram.
